You
never know who these people may be but when you lock eyes with them, you
know that very moment that they will affect your life in some
profound
way.
And
sometimes things happen to you at a time that may seem horrible, painful
and unfair, but in reflection you realize that without overcoming these
obstacles you would have never realized your potential, strength, or will
power.

Everything
happens for a reason. Nothing happens by chance or by means of good luck,
illness, injury, love or lost moments of true greatness.
All
occur to test the limits of your soul.
Without
these small tests, life would be like a smoothly paved, straight, flat
road to nowhere. Safe and comfortable but dull and utterly pointless.
The
people you meet affect your life. The successes and downfalls that you
experience can create who you are, and the bad experiences can be learned
from. In fact, they are probably the most poignant and important ones.
If
someone hurts you, betrays you or breaks your heart, forgive them because
they have helped you learn about trust and the importance of being cautious
to whom you open your heart.
If
someone loves you,
love
them back unconditionally, not only because they love you, but because
they are teaching you to love and to open your heart, and
eyes
to little things.
Make
every day count, appreciate every moment and take from it everything that
you possibly can, for you may never be able to
experience
it again.
Let
yourself fall in love, break free and set your sights high.
Hold
your head up because you have every right to.
Tell
yourself you are a great individual and believe in yourself, for if you
don't, no one else will believe in you.
Create
your own life and then go out and live it.
If
you take your eyes off your goals,
all
you see are obstacles.
